The melodrama tells the story of the Greek goddess Persephone, in three parts:
1. L`enlèvement de Perséphone (The Abduction of Persephone);
2. Perséphone aux Enfers (Persephone in the Underworld);
3. Renaissance de Perséphone (Rebirth of Persephone).
